Bashでテキスト行を確認する

Bashでテキスト行を確認する

これは非常に愚かな質問ですが、どこでも答えを見つけることができません。そのため、次のテキスト行を印刷するコマンドがあります。

htop
kvantum
alacritty

部分文字列ではなく行を確認する必要があります。

答え1

アンカーポイントを使用してください。たとえば、次のようになります。

grep '^kvantum$' ...

答え2

ロボットを使っsedgrep正規表現を活用します。合わせたいならプレーンテキスト文字列 awk良い選択かもしれません。

$0まったくそうではないワイヤー- またはもう少し正確に記録RSデフォルトは改行で区切られます。

awk '$0 == "some line with $ and * and ..."' file

または変数を介して:

awk -v find='some line with $ and * and ...' '$0 == find' file

関連情報